Near Ålesund, amongst the string of islands that spreads outwards towards the ocean, there is a wealth of outstanding ocean wildlife and natural landscapes to discover and explore. And because we well know the Nordic Sea and its wild whims, we have equipped ourselves to be fully prepared for the ever-changing moods and furies of our natural Norwegian weather. So join us where wild things wander and we’ll take you on an unforgettable journey of discovery of the remote Norwegian outer islands with all the varied and unique ocean species that call it home.

Sail over the ocean to the outward outposts of Nordic nature and get up close to the unique local wildlife in a non-intrusive, but naturally immersive manner. This Wildlife Sea Safari will make you feel like you’re in the middle of your own National Geographic wildlife TV series. Gaze out on seal colonies, the occasional whale, pods of dolphins and a wide and wonderful variety of Atlantic puffins, Black-legged kittiwakes, Common guillemots, Fulmars, Razorbills, and Northern gannets to name just a few of the bird species on view. All on a secluded nature reserve that doubles as a nesting ground and repository for endangered species.
